A global compilation of diatom silica oxygen isotope records from lake sediment - trends and implications for climate reconstruction

Oxygen isotopes in biogenic silica (δ18OBSi) from lake sediments allow for quantitative reconstruction of past hydroclimate and proxy-model comparison in terrestrial environments. The signals of individual records have been attributed to different factors, such as air temperature (Tair), atmospheric circulation patterns, hydrological changes, and lake evaporation. White clover pollinators and seed set in relation to local management and landscape context

Bees are declining, which is worrisome since they both have intrinsic conservation value and play a major role as pollinators in both natural and managed ecosystems. Land use change and lack of suitable habitats are often suggested as driving forces of bee decline. Improved Cloud Parameterization in Global Climate Model : Aerosol effects and secondary ice production mechanisms

The response of clouds to the changes in climate is uncertain, and the representation of the cloud-climate feedback is a key challenge in the global circulation models (GCM) for future climate projections. Factors contributing to this uncertainty include processes that involve particles of various sizes and phases, as well as the interactions between these particles and the surrounding atmosphere.

On approximating dependence function and its derivatives

Bivariate extreme value distributions can be used to model dependence of observations from random variables in extreme levels. There is no finite dimensional parametric family for these distributions, but they can be characterized by a certain one-dimensional function which is known as Pickands dependence function.
